Lyocell material is susceptible to mildew. Raw cellulose is dissolved in a solvent of amine oxide, which is then filtered and extruded into a dilute aqueous bath of amine oxide and coagulated into fibre form. The lyocell process uses a direct solvent rather than indirect dissolution such as the xanthation-regeneration route in the viscose process. What Is Lyocell Fabric? Lyocell ironing is simple, just hover over the item using the steam setting, or press using a warm setting. Lyocell will shrink about 3% with the first washing, and will resist shrinking from then on. Few chemicals are used, among which N-methyl morpholine-N-oxide (NMMO) and water are almost recycled, which makes the process economically favourable (Rosenau et al., 2001; Dawson, 2012).
